Ahead of the upcoming edition of the Indian Premier League (IPL 2026), Nitish Rana has been traded from Rajasthan Royals to Delhi Capitals, and Donovan Ferreira rejoins the Rajasthan Royals.

As per the transfer agreement, Donovan Ferreira’s fee has been revised from ₹75 lakh to ₹1 crore. Nitish Rana will continue at his existing fee of ₹4.2 crore.

Following the acquisitions of Ravindra Jadeja and Sam Curran, Donovan’s return adds more power, flexibility and finishing strength to the Royals’ batting options.

The South African was part of the Rajasthan Royals setup for IPL 2024.

The right-handed wicketkeeper-batter has an overall T20 strike rate of more than 160 and can also bowl handy off-breaks.

Kumar Sangakkara, Director of Cricket, Rajasthan Royals, said, “Donovan brings a mix of power-hitting and game awareness. He understands our environment, and he fits the brand of cricket we want to play. We’re delighted to have him back. At the same time, we thank Nitish for his contributions and wish him the very best.”

Donovan Ferreira said, “It feels great to return to a familiar environment. I’ve had a good chat with Kumar and I’m looking forward to playing my role for the Royals.”
